(SoloAzar Exclusive).- Jean-Luc Ferrière, Fast Track Chief Commercial Officer & MD Americas, granted an interview to SoloAzar in which he explained about the main products of the firm, the activity for the current year and the market expansion and achievements, among other issues.

How did the company begin, in which market? Can you explain and describe the main products of Fast Track?
Fast Track is a well-established player within the European market and has spent the past seven years cementing its global footprint as the iGaming CRM leader. Europe remains a focus for us, and we’re excited to be physically expanding into the Americas, having recently established our presence there with a new office in Miami, to be better able to serve our partners on that side of the Atlantic.
Fast Track is the only CRM platform built specifically for the online gambling industry. At its core, FT is a player engagement platform acting as the central brain for all player orchestration and is designed to provide true 1:1 experiences at scale. The beauty of Fast Track is that it runs exclusively on real-time data, unlocking a whole new level of possibilities for data analysis, having real-time data dashboards load up in seconds, and giving operators the opportunity to automate an extensive part of their CRM processes. The recently launched OpenAi integration is another step towards our vision of delivering the first self-learning CRM platform to the industry.

Do you want to name the highlighted awards that the firm received, and what does it mean for the firm?
One of our proudest achievements in the past months is our Great Place to Work® certification. Great Place to Work surveys 19.8 million employees across 10,000 participating organizations spread over 5 continents and 90 countries and requires a 70% score on the Trust index to obtain certification. Fast Track obtained a score of 93%, ranking it amongst the best employers globally. Apart from this, we were also named ‘Employer of The Year’ at the IGA awards taking place in London last February.
